Output bab40b63c2d3dd33fd105065ff2bb2e9b371689020fe2d9ac7fb990ef622fdac:17

value
108870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f6b5bef4c010a7f3b5cf25818f954ca6934a783 OP_EQUAL
address
3LbkQhGY6EbqYoiaVTzmL5ZhJtAENK3x4P
transaction
bab40b63c2d3dd33fd105065ff2bb2e9b371689020fe2d9ac7fb990ef622fdac
spent
true